Common questions

When is the best time to send a get well soon card to my dad?

Send it as soon as you learn about his illness or recovery. A timely message shows immediate support and concern, which can be particularly meaningful during the early stages of recovery.

What tone should I use in a professional get well soon message for my father?

Use a respectful, supportive tone that acknowledges his situation without being overly emotional. Focus on wishing him strength, comfort, and a smooth recovery while maintaining the dignity appropriate for your relationship.

Should I include specific offers of help in the card?

Yes, offering specific, practical help can be valuable. Mention concrete ways you can assist, such as handling tasks, providing meals, or scheduling visits, rather than using vague offers like 'let me know if you need anything.'
